Subject: APPROVAL of NEUSE RIPARIAN BUFFER IMPACTS
Spring Branch Community Restoration Project
Mr. Wensman,
You have our approval for the impacts listed below for the purpose described in your application
received by the N.C. Division of Water Resources (Division) on April 9, 2021, and subsequent information
on September 17, 2021. These impacts are covered by the Neuse Buffer Rules and the conditions listed
below. This Buffer Authorization does not relieve the permittee of the responsibility to obtain all other
required Federal, State, or Local approvals before proceeding with the project, including those required
by, but not limited to, Sediment and Erosion Control, Non -Discharge, Water Supply Watershed, and/or
Stormwater regulations.
The following impacts are hereby approved, provided that all of the Conditions listed below, and all of
the conditions of the Neuse Buffer Rules are met. No other impacts are approved, including incidental
impacts. [15A NCAC 02B .0611(b)(2)]

This approval is for the purpose and design described in your application. The plans and specifications
for this project are incorporated by reference as part of this Authorization Certificate. If you change
your project, you must notify the Division and you may be required to submit a new application
package. If the property is sold, the new owner must be given a copy of this Authorization Certificate
and is responsible for complying with all conditions. [15A NCAC 02B .0611(b)(2)]

If you are unable to comply with any of the conditions below, you must notify the Raleigh Regional
Office within 24 hours (or the next business day if a weekend or holiday) from the time the permittee
becomes aware of the circumstances.
The permittee shall report to the Raleigh Regional Office any noncompliance with the conditions of this
Authorization Certificate and/or any violation of state regulated riparian buffer rules [15A NCAC
02B .0714]. Information shall be provided orally within 24 hours (or the next business day if a weekend
or holiday) from the time the applicant became aware of the circumstances.
This approval and its conditions are final and binding unless contested. [G.S. 143-215.5] Upon the
presentation of proper credentials, the Division may inspect the property.
This Authorization Certificate can be contested as provided in Chapter 150B of the North Carolina
General Statutes by filing a Petition for a Contested Case Hearing (Petition) with the North Carolina
Office of Administrative Hearings (OAH) within sixty (60) calendar days. Requirements for filing a
Petition are set forth in Chapter 150B of the North Carolina General Statutes and Title 26 of the North
Carolina Administrative Code. Additional information regarding requirements for filing a Petition and
Petition forms may be accessed at http://www.ncoah.comi or by calling the OAH Clerk's Office at (919)
431-3000.

This Authorization Certificate neither grants nor affirms any property right, license, or privilege in any
lands or waters, or any right of use in any waters. This Authorization Certificate does not authorize any
person to interfere with the riparian rights, littoral rights, or water use rights of any other person, nor
does it create any prescriptive right or any right of priority regarding any usage of water. This
Authorization Certificate shall not be interposed as a defense in any action respecting the determination
of riparian or littoral rights or other rights to water use. No consumptive user is deemed by virtue of this
Authorization Certificate to possess any prescriptive or other right of priority with respect to any other
consumptive user.
This Authorization shall expire when the corresponding 401 Water Quality Certification Approval DWR
# 20210732 expires.
This letter completes the Division's review under the Neuse Riparian Buffer Rules as described in 15A
NCAC 02B .0714. Please contact Rick Trone at rick.trone@ncdenr.eov if you have any questions or
concerns.
